Crystalline Extracellular Nuclease of Staphylococcus aureus

Volume: 241, Issue: 19, Pages: 4389 - 4390
Published: Oct 10, 1966
Abstract
Three crystal forms of an extracellular nuclease of Staphylococcus aureus, strains V8 and Foggi, have been obtained. One of these forms crystallizes in the tetragonal space group P41 (or P43) with unit cell dimensions of a = b = 48.1 A, c = 63.5 A, and 4 molecules per unit cell. Work is in progress on the structure of this enzyme at 4A resolution by three-dimensional methods. Several isomorphous substitutions, e.g. with UO22+ and...
